What a Zestimate gives you

Zillow's estimate is an automated model. It updates often, it covers a huge share of U.S. homes, and for a quick gut check it is fine. The problem is not that it exists. The problem is that it behaves like a black box. You get a dollar figure. You do not get the comparable sales, the confidence band, or a plain explanation of what was adjusted and why.

When the number feels wrong, you have nowhere to go. You cannot see whether it priced your condo off houses, whether it counted a bulk portfolio sale, or whether it leaned on a list price that was never meant to be the value. You are left arguing with an algorithm you cannot inspect.

The Sunset house where the ask was not the value

Start with 1573 19th Ave, a five-bedroom house in the Sunset. Public records show 1,881 square feet, built in 1926, held by the same family since 1994. It listed in May at $949,000 and came off the market in June without selling.

Our first pass, looking only at nearby sales, came back around $2.4 million. An AI second opinion we keep for comparison said $2.35 million. Both ignored the list price in any serious way. When we fed the $949,000 ask in, the systems split. The algorithm still anchored on renovated comps in the low $2 millions. The AI parked on the ask itself, treating $949,000 as the seller knowing something the record does not.

Neither was quite right. In that neighborhood, the median recent sale closed at 1.5 times the list price. Only 3 of 27 sold within 5% of what they asked. A Zestimate-style single number hides that entirely. You might see $949,000 or $2.2 million and have no way to know which story the model believed.

The short version: we now convert a list price into what similar homes actually sold for, discount stale listings, and apply a modest tenure adjustment when a home has not traded in decades. On this house the blended estimate landed around $1.85 million, with a tighter range than either black-box extreme.

The Noe Valley condo priced like a two-bedroom

The second case is a one-bedroom, one-bath condo of about 640 square feet near 1020 Noe St in Noe Valley. Built around 1900, in a four-unit building that has been marketed as a package with TIC financing. Facts like that rarely show up in a county deed.

Inside the Noe Valley boundary, the recent condo sales on file were almost all two-bedroom, two-bath units of 1,000 square feet or more. An older version of our ladder treated "inside the neighborhood" as good enough. It valued the one-bedroom off those larger units, at roughly $1,800 a square foot, and produced a number north of a million dollars for a 640-square-foot unit.

The similar one-bedrooms had sold just outside the polygon, a few blocks away, in the $830,000 to $920,000 range. A Zestimate-style output gives you no way to catch that mismatch. You see one big number. You do not see that every comp was the wrong size.

We fixed the ladder so property type and bedroom count are hard constraints at every level. A neighborhood boundary can narrow the search; it cannot substitute for similarity. The algorithm now reaches for those one-bedrooms outside the polygon before it prices a small condo like a large one. That change is pinned in our test suite so it cannot quietly regress.
